Power System Engineer (Restoration Engineer) - NESO

National Energy System Operator

The Role

Overview

Senior engineer overseeing implementation of Electricity System Restoration Standard

Key Responsibilities

  • technical assessment
  • compliance management
  • program management
  • market development
  • risk integration
  • stakeholder engagement

Tasks

-Engage with industry stakeholders to ensure that the implementation of the Restoration Standard takes their perspectives into account where feasible. -Support interactions with DESNZ, Ofgem, and other industry forums regarding ESRS. -Develop/continue any required New Markets and/or funding mechanisms for providers -Coordinate with other NESO functions to integrate ESRS, system risks, and resilience considerations into their activities. -Framework(s) to enable contributions to the Electricity System Restoration (ESR) from a wider range of technologies -Oversee the development and execution of necessary changes to ensure NESO's readiness and compliance with ESRS obligations. -Represent NESO at external groups and forums. -Reporting on progress for the Restoration Standard implementation. -Initiate/continue relevant regulatory framework changes and updates -Provide leadership and guidance for the Future Restoration team, which is responsible for: -Establish and maintain effective working relationships with all relevant stakeholders and customers, both internal and external, addressing liaison matters as needed. -Support the management of the multi-layered plan for implementing and delivering the ESRS for NESO, providing updates to the NESO Executive Team on programme delivery. -Offer technical assessment capabilities to complement commercial assessments of CUSC parties’ resilient claims.

What You Bring

-Strong stakeholder engagement skills, with an aptitude for effective collaboration and influence among diverse parties in the energy industry and within NESO, while managing potentially conflicting interests. -Demonstrated knowledge of electricity system operations. -Experience in data management and information analysis. -Proven ability to manage projects involving multiple internal and external deliverables. -Familiarity with electricity licences, codes, and framework agreements (including GC, STC, CUSC, and SQSS). -New IT tools to support restoration -Demonstrates knowledge of generation technologies, including thermal, hydro, wind, solar, storage, and interconnectors. While not at an expert level, possesses a clear understanding of how these technologies operate and participate within the system. -Comprehensive understanding of the energy sector, preferably supported by experience across various utilities such as Transmission Operators (TOs), Distribution Network Operators (DNOs), System Operators, and Generators. -Capacity to establish strong networks within the industry and promote a culture of co-creation for the ESRS. -Understanding of electricity market operations, balancing schemes, and the Balancing Settlement Code.
